Letter from C.C. Wakefield & Co. Ltd confirming they will supply 5-gallons of CASTROL 'R' oil free of charge for testing on Hypoid bevel gears.

Identifier  ExFiles\Box 145\2\  scan0218
Date  1st January 1929

Dear Sirs,

Please accept our thanks for your favour of the 28th. ult., concerning CASTROL "R" for Hypoid bevel gears.

The copy of letter you have received from the Gleason Co. makes the position quite clear, and we have instructed our New York House to supply them with 5-gallons CASTROL "R" free for the purpose of the test. We have also requested them to render any assistance in their power.
